Which condition does not affect the efficiency of a hydraulic filter?

The efficiency of a hydraulic filter is influenced by several critical factors that determine how effectively it can remove contaminants from the fluid. The viscosity of the fluid impacts how easily it flows through the filter and affects the filter's ability to capture particles. The size of particles in the fluid is directly related to the filter's design and capability, as filters are often rated for specific ranges of particle sizes. The type of fluid used can also matter, as different fluids can have varying properties that influence how they interact with the filter media.

In contrast, the color of the fluid does not affect the filter's efficiency. Color is primarily an aesthetic and diagnostic feature, providing little to no information about the fluid's physical properties that are relevant to filtration performance. As such, it does not impact how well a hydraulic filter functions in terms of its ability to trap particles or maintain fluid flow.
